anyone got any advice for very sore eyes after doing 11 out of 12 hours on a night shift, don't suppose staring at the vdu has helped though!!

anyone got any advice for very sore eyes after doing 11 out of 12 hours on a night shift, don't suppose staring at the vdu has helped though!!

sure....cheap n easy... make a pot of tea, cool 2 tea bags, squeeze them a bit so they don't drip, lie back and put them on your eyes.

The tannic acid in the tea refreshes nicely; takes about an hour. Works really well for swelling.

Enjoy!
